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We begin by assessing the extent of the water damage and planning the best course of action to restore your documents. Our team will carefully inspect each document to find out the level of damage. This helps us develop a customized plan to dry and restore your documents to their original condition. We take the time to explain the process to you, so you know exactly what to expect.
Step 2: Removing Excess Water
Next, our team uses advanced equipment to extract excess water from your documents and surrounding areas. We use specialized vacuums and pumps to remove water quickly and efficiently. This helps prevent further damage and ensures your documents can be restored to their former condition. We take care to avoid causing further damage to your documents or surrounding are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After removing excess water, our team uses spec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your documents. We use heat and air circulation systems to dry your documents quickly and evenly. This helps prevent warping or discoloration, ensuring your documents are restored to their original condition. We take the time to carefully monitor the drying process to ensure your documents are properly dried.
Step 4: Cleaning and Restoration
Once your documents are dry, our team begins the cleaning and restoration process. We use specialized cleaning solutions and techniques to remove dirt and debris from your documents. This helps restore your documents to their original condition, ensuring they’re in great shape. We take care to avoid causing further damage to your documents or surrounding areas.
Step 5: Storage and Preservation
Finally, our team provides specialized storage and preservation services to ensure your documents remain in great condition. We use acid-free boxes and materials to store your documents, preventing further damage. This helps ensure your documents remain in great shape for years to come. We take the time to explain the storage and preservation process to you, so you know exactly what to expect.

Document Drying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age to a few documents | Yes | No | You can easily dry and restore the documents yourself. |
| Large water damage to many documents | No | Yes | It’s best to call a professional to ensure proper drying and preservation. |
| Water damage to important historical documents | No | Yes | These documents need specialized care and handling. |
| Water damage to documents with sensitive materials | No | Yes | These documents need specialized care and handling to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to documents in a large area | No | Yes | It’s best to call a professional to ensure proper drying and preservation of the affected area. |
| Water damage to documents with a strong musty smell | No | Yes | This smell may show a bigger problem, and a professional should be called to investigate. |
